Game Details:

The story of "Contra" is set in the future, where the alien creatures "Red Falcon" threaten the safety of Earth. The protagonists, Bill and Lance, are ordered to go deep behind enemy lines to destroy their base. The game proceeds in a horizontal scrolling manner, with a total of 8 levels, including side-scrolling, overhead, and 3D corridor perspectives.

Players enhance their combat power by collecting floating letter weapons (such as S spread shot, L laser, F flame, etc.). The game is known for its fast pace, precise judgments, and high difficulty, and the well-known "30 lives cheat code" (↑↑↓↓←→←→BA) has also become a classic legend among players.

Game Walkthrough:

  • Weapon Selection: It is recommended to prioritize obtaining the S (Spread) shotgun, which has a large range and strong power, and is a tool for clearing levels; the L (Laser) has high damage but is difficult to hit.
  • Jumping Rhythm: Precise jumping is required in multi-platform scenarios, be sure to familiarize yourself with enemy refresh points and attack rhythms.
  • Boss Battles: Most bosses have fixed attack patterns, observe and then focus your firepower on the gaps; more people working together makes it easier to break through.
  • No-Damage Techniques: Use terrain and weapon coverage to achieve no-damage level clearance; sometimes "pausing" is safer than blindly charging.
  • Using Cheats: Enter "↑↑↓↓←→←→BA" on the main interface to get 30 lives, which helps newbies familiarize themselves with the levels.
